Job Details
Our Med/Surg RN's:
  • Assess, monitor, administer medication, document progress, and manage overall care for medical/surgical patients.
  • Partner with an interdisciplinary team including, but not limited to, attending physicians, registered nurses (RN), and ancillary staff to optimize patient outcomes and satisfaction.
  • Advocate for and build meaningful relationships with patients and their loved ones through safety intervention, emotional support and education.
What you'll bring:
  • Passion for Oncology
  • 1+ years of Registered Nurse (RN) experience in Oncology preferred
  • 1+ years of Registered Nurse (RN) medical/surgical experience with an interest in Oncology
  • Education: Bachelors of Science in Nursing (BSN) degree
  • Will consider Associates Degree if enrolled in an accredited BSN program
  • Licensure: New York Registered Nurse (RN) License & Registration
  • Certification: Basic Life Support (BLS) required
Salary Range

USD $56.39 - USD $73.66 /Hr.

This range serves as a good faith estimate and actual pay will encompass a number of factors, including a candidate’s qualifications, skills, competencies and experience. The salary range or rate listed does not include any bonuses/incentive, differential pay or other forms of compensation that may be applicable to this job and it does not include the value of benefits.
